Beijing to London 2002 - Train out of China
From Worldtraveller
I arrived at Beijing Station feeling sad to be leaving China. It was a beautiful fresh morning, and as I passed Tiananmen Square on my way to the station, the raising of the flag ceremony was getting under way in the dawn light. But I was also looking forward to the journey ahead, and anticipating great things when the train pulled slowly out of the station at just after 7am.
The first day went very quickly. I watched Beijing slowly get sparser and the countryside emerge from beneath it, and then for a long time watched out for bits of the Great Wall which appeared by the track. By the evening we were in the grasslands of Inner Mongolia, and soon after nightfall we reached the border at Erlian, where all the wheels on the train were changed so that the train could continue on Mongolia's wider tracks.
